What is it like to be in the Laravel community?
Being part of the Laravel community is considered one of the best experiences in modern web development. The community is friendly, supportive, and very professional, making it easy for developers to learn and grow.
Beginner-Friendly and Supportive Environment
The Laravel community is very welcoming to beginners. If someone asks questions about routes, controllers, or authentication in Laravel 12, experienced developers usually explain things clearly and politely using simple examples.
High-Quality Learning Resources
Laravel provides some of the best learning resources available for developers. These include:
- Official Laravel Documentation – Clear, updated, and practical
- Laracasts – Step-by-step video tutorials for all skill levels
- Laravel News – Updates, tips, and community packages
Active Global Community Support
Laravel developers actively help each other across multiple platforms such as GitHub, Stack Overflow, Discord, and Twitter (X). This makes it easy to find quick solutions and follow best practices for Laravel 12 projects.
Open-Source and Community Contributions
Laravel is open-source, and many developers contribute useful packages to the ecosystem. While the Laravel team maintains tools like Breeze and Sanctum, the community builds popular packages such as the Spatie packages and the Filament admin panel.
Laracon and Local Meetups
The Laravel community regularly connects through events like Laracon, the official Laravel conference, and local Laravel meetups worldwide. These events help developers learn directly from experts, share real-world experience, and stay updated with Laravel 12 changes.
Focus on Clean Code and Developer Happiness
The Laravel community strongly promotes clean code, modern PHP standards, security, and developer happiness. Tools like Forge and Envoyer are commonly discussed to help with smooth deployment and maintenance.
Final Summary
Being part of the Laravel community feels like having a global support system. Developers learn faster, build better applications, and stay updated with Laravel 12 best practices through shared knowledge, events, and open-source collaboration.
